On Mon, May 27, 2019 at 02:15:34AM +0200, Niklas Söderlund wrote:
> Replace all usage of FormatEnum with V4L2SubdeviceFormats and completely
> remove FormatEnum which is no longer needed.
>
> Signed-off-by: Niklas Söderlund <niklas.soderlund at ragnatech.se>
> ---
> src/libcamera/camera_sensor.cpp | 12 +++++-------
> src/libcamera/formats.cpp | 11 -----------
> src/libcamera/include/formats.h | 2 --
> src/libcamera/include/v4l2_subdevice.h | 2 +-
> src/libcamera/v4l2_subdevice.cpp | 6 +++---
> test/v4l2_subdevice/list_formats.cpp | 10 +++++-----
> 6 files changed, 14 insertions(+), 29 deletions(-)
>
> diff --git a/src/libcamera/camera_sensor.cpp b/src/libcamera/camera_sensor.cpp
> index 2b9d8fa593c13177..e46bc28c7ac4a8e1 100644
> --- a/src/libcamera/camera_sensor.cpp
> +++ b/src/libcamera/camera_sensor.cpp
> @@ -90,27 +90,25 @@ int CameraSensor::init()
> return ret;
>
> /* Enumerate and cache media bus codes and sizes. */
> - const FormatEnum formats = subdev_->formats(0);
> + const V4L2SubdeviceFormats formats = subdev_->formats(0);
> if (formats.empty()) {
> LOG(CameraSensor, Error) << "No image format found";
> return -EINVAL;
> }
>
> - std::transform(formats.begin(), formats.end(),
> - std::back_inserter(mbusCodes_),
> - [](decltype(*formats.begin()) f) { return f.first; });
> + mbusCodes_ = formats.codes();
>
> /*
> * Extract the supported sizes from the first format as we only support
> * sensors that offer the same frame sizes for all media bus codes.
> * Verify this assumption and reject the sensor if it isn't true.
> */
> - const std::vector<SizeRange> &sizes = formats.begin()->second;
> + const std::vector<SizeRange> &sizes = formats.sizes(mbusCodes_[0]);
> std::transform(sizes.begin(), sizes.end(), std::back_inserter(sizes_),
> [](const SizeRange &range) { return range.max; });
>
> - for (auto it = ++formats.begin(); it != formats.end(); ++it) {
> - if (it->second != sizes) {
> + for (unsigned int code : mbusCodes_) {
> + if (formats.sizes(code) != sizes) {
> LOG(CameraSensor, Error)
> << "Frame sizes differ between media bus codes";
> return -EINVAL;
